How the System Actually Tries to Work Midnight Network leans heavily on zero knowledge proofs, but not in a way that feels abstract or purely academic. The idea is simple to say but difficult to build. You can prove something is true without revealing the underlying data. In practice, this means a transaction or interaction can be verified by the network without exposing sensitive details. If this is done correctly, it becomes possible to build applications where users remain in control of their information while still benefiting from decentralized infrastructure. What matters here is not just the cryptography, but how it is integrated into the system’s architecture. Privacy cannot feel like an extra feature layered on top. It has to be part of the foundation. Midnight seems to be moving in that direction by designing around selective disclosure, where users decide what to reveal and when. That subtle shift changes how applications are built. Instead of broadcasting everything, systems become more intentional, more aligned with how real institutions and individuals operate outside of blockchain.
